A Summary of Metal Polishing - Usually, the polishing of metal is desirable for aesthetic reasons as well as clean-room uses. It's one of the most recognized methods simply because of its use in boosting the natural beauty of the item, for instance, automobile parts, kitchenware or motorcycle parts. What's more, various clean-rooms desire a sleek finish as a way to limit the penetrability of the material which will result in dirt to gather and contaminate. A superb demonstration of this practice might be in vacuum chambers.

You'll find plenty of methods of finish metal, and here let us go over a bit concerning a number of the procedures involved. Various metals can be finished electromechanically, chemically, by hand, or with purpose built buffing machines. A buffing compound or paste is often employed, which can consist of a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its poor thermal conductivity, somewhat high viscosity, and hardness is just about the time intensive. Conversely, products crafted from non-ferrous metals tend to be receptive to polishing, simply because these call for the minimum number of operations.

A lower pad speed is employed in the event that a top quality mirror finish is critical. Finishing buffs coated in paste can be seriously impacted by the pressures on the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face might be increased within certain constraints, although going above the most effective amount of force not merely cuts down on the quality level of treatment, but also reduces the level of performance, might result in wear to the component, and also an evident heating up of the metal being worked on, brought about by friction. When polishing thinner items, it's higher heat (and the resulting pliancy of the metal) which can cause materials to twist, buckle or distort. Commonly, it takes a specialized technician to factor in every one of these things to equally avoid harm to the metal part and to perform proficiently. In order to radically increase the standard of the finished finish, the finishing procedure is required to be done with considerably less aggression and not as much force in order to in the end complete a surface area that is free of scores or marks left behind by the finishing process, thereby ending up with a brilliant mirror finish.
